NYA set to organise Youth Festival this August

Ghana is set to host its maiden National Youth Festival this August, in line with International Youth Day on August 12, as announced by Osman Ayariga Esq., CEO of the National Youth Authority (NYA).

According to Mr. Ayariga, the NYA is spearheading this groundbreaking initiative to address the critical challenges facing the country’s youth — going beyond just employment and training to focus on holistic well-being.

“This festival is not only about jobs and skills. It’s also about the emotional and mental wellness of our young people,” he noted.

The week-long Ghana Youth Festival will feature conferences, forums, and awareness campaigns centered around issues such as mental health, drug abuse, unemployment, and other social and economic hurdles. Special attention will be given to mental health, which Mr. Ayariga emphasized as key to achieving real youth empowerment.

“If the mental health of our youth is unstable, training and jobs alone won’t bring the transformation we need,” he stressed.

One of the major highlights will be a nationwide street campaign against drug abuse, in addition to discussions on youth entrepreneurship, leadership, digital skills, and civic engagement.

The festival will wrap up with youth-centered entertainment and recreational activities, creating a dynamic and inclusive platform that celebrates and uplifts Ghana’s youth.

“This is a historic first for NYA—an event of this scale that places youth development at the heart of national dialogue,” Mr. Ayariga added. “Our goal is to drive change, foster resilience, and ensure young people are meaningfully included in national development.”

Following the festival, NYA will roll out a Youth Fellowship Programme in October, offering young Ghanaians more opportunities to grow, connect, and lead. The National Youth Festival is expected to become an annual celebration that unites youth across the country, amplifies their voices, and influences policy for a brighter future.
